Why is red light refracted the least?

Each beam of light has its own particular wavelength and is slowed differently by the glass . Violet light has a shorter wavelength; hence, it is slowed more than the longer wavelengths of red light. Consequently, violet light is bent the most while the red light is bent the least.

How is a rainbow formed Class 7?

Just after rain, there are large number of small water drops suspended in the atmosphere. ... As the white sunlight enters and leaves these tiny water drops , the various coloured rays of sunlight are deviated by different amounts and a long arch of seven colours formed in the sky called rainbow.
